Keeping Your Gaming PC Cool and Quiet
Heat is the biggest enemy of your computer. When a PC gets too hot, it slows itself down to stay safe. This is called thermal throttling. You might notice your fans getting very loud while your game starts to lag. It is a sign that your system is struggling to stay cool.
Cleaning your PC is the best thing you can do for its health. Dust acts like a blanket that traps heat inside. You can use a can of compressed air to blow out the dust from your fans. Do this every few months to keep the air flowing well. A clean PC runs faster and lasts much longer.
If your PC still runs hot, you might need better airflow. Make sure your computer is not pushed against a wall. It needs space to pull in fresh air and push out the hot air. Some gamers also add more fans to their cases. This is a cheap update that can stop those sudden lag spikes caused by heat.

Why Fast Storage and RAM Matter Now
In the past, people thought any RAM or hard drive was fine. That is no longer true for modern gaming. New games are very big and have huge worlds to load. If your storage is slow, you will see long loading screens. You might even see the ground disappear while you run through the game.
Switching to an NVMe SSD is the best upgrade you can make. These drives are much faster than old hard drives. They allow the game to load in just a few seconds. RAM is also very important for stability. You should aim for at least 16GB or 32GB of DDR5 RAM. This helps your PC handle the game and your background apps without crashing. Think of RAM like a large desk. The more desk space you have, the more projects you can work on at the same time without making a mess.

Is 8GB of RAM enough for 2026?
No, 8GB is now considered too low for most new games. You will see a lot of stuttering and slow performance. Upgrading to at least 16GB will make a massive difference in how your PC feels.
How often should I clean my PC?
You should do a light cleaning every three months. A deep cleaning with a can of air should happen once a year. This keeps your parts safe and your fans quiet.
